Description

On March 21,2025, SeneNews.com experienced a cyberattack that rendered its website difficult to access. The attack generated more than 300 million requests within a few hours, according to the company's CEO Massamba KANE. He described the scale of the incident as unprecedented. The incident disrupted the site's digital infrastructure and prevented the editorial team from delivering its usual services to readers.

As a result of the attack, the SeneNews.com platform was temporarily unavailable, interrupting the flow of news content. The company immediately began working with competent authorities to evaluate the extent of the damage and to determine appropriate measures for future prevention. Technical teams were mobilized to address the intrusion and to assess the impact on systems and data.

For over 24 hours, the technical staff have been engaged in identifying the origin of the intrusion, reinforcing the security of the systems, and striving to restore access to the platform as quickly as possible. In the meantime, updates have been shared via social media and other communication channels. SeneNews.com has thanked its readers for their patience and fidelity, and reiterated that the security of its services and the protection of user data remain an absolute priority.
